loc setitem fails with shape mismatch · Issue #51450 · pandas-dev/pandas · GitHub

Pandas version checks Reproducible Example
import pandas as pd

df = pd.DataFrame({
    "A": [],
    "B": []
}).astype('str')

df.loc[df['A'].str.contains('STUFF'), ['A']] = df['A'] + '-' + df['B']
Issue Description

In versions 1.5+ this errors with ValueError: shape mismatch: value array of shape (0,) could not be broadcast to indexing result of shape (0,1)

Expected Behavior

In pre 1.5 this behaved as a no-op.
